Business News: Immunology Drug Companies Alumis and Acelyrin to Merge

The Dermatology Digest

Alumis Inc. and ACELYRIN, INC. are set to merge. The companies announced a definitive merger agreement under which Alumis and ACELYRIN will merge in an all-stock transaction. The transaction is expected to close in the second quarter of 2025, subject to approval by the stockholders of both companies and satisfaction of other customary closing conditions.

Thermo Fisher Scientific Launches International CorEvitas Adolescent AA Clinical Registry

The Dermatology Digest

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c is launching the international CorEvitas Adolescent Alopecia Areata (AA) Registry. Data collected will enable research to help better understand the burden of disease for AA patients, as well as the real-world effectiveness and safety of newly approved treatments. The registry is now active in both Europe and the U.S., with the first patient recently enrolled in Europe and the first patient in North America enrolled in late 2024.
